The Eurovision Semi-Final draw is always a pivotal moment in the contest, determining which countries will compete against each other for a coveted spot in the Grand Final on May 17th. With a mix of powerhouse nations, fan-favorites, and returning countries, Eurovision 2025 promises to be a spectacular edition. Letโs take a look at how the Semi-Finals are shaping up!
Semi-Final 1 โ Tuesday, May 13th (21:00 CEST)
The first Semi-Final will see a thrilling lineup of artists battling for qualification. Hereโs how the draw has divided the countries:
